Household consumption in December final yr decreased by 1.3% year-on-year, reducing for 2 consecutive months | NHK

According to the Family Income and Expenditure Survey in December final yr, the sum of money spent on consumption by households with two or extra individuals decreased by 1.3% from the identical month of the earlier yr in actual phrases, excluding worth fluctuations. The lower appears to be because of the results of successive worth hikes of meals merchandise for the second consecutive month.

According to the Ministry of Internal Affairs and Communications, in a December survey final yr, households with two or extra individuals spent 328,114 yen per family.

In actual phrases, excluding worth fluctuations, it decreased by 1.3% from the identical month of the earlier yr, marking the second straight month of decline.

Looking on the breakdown, “food” decreased by 3.6%, marking the third consecutive month of decline.

Spending on seafood and alcoholic drinks is down, doubtless as a consequence of successive worth hikes in meals.

In addition, “housing” decreased by 13.8%.

This was as a consequence of a lower in housing gear restore prices and lease.

On the opposite hand, demand for energy-saving air conditioners elevated as a consequence of rising electrical energy payments, resulting in a 5.6% enhance in furnishings and family items.

In addition, the month-to-month common quantity spent by households with two or extra individuals final yr was 290,865 yen per family, up 1.2% from the earlier yr.

It was the second consecutive yr of enhance.

The Ministry of Internal Affairs and Communications mentioned, “Although the typical consumption quantity for the previous yr was optimistic, it has not recovered to the extent earlier than the unfold of the brand new coronavirus an infection. .
